PostPosted: Sat Sep 01, 2007 6:52 pm    Post subject: UNKNOWN ERROR 2 Reply with quote

I received an UNKNOWN ERROR 2 on my first try using GIXEN. When the error is viewed the core page data looks fine, although the header data is rather confusing. My maximum bid was well above the current so that isn't the problem.

Any ideas of how I should do things different in the future to avoid this problem? If you need additional details let me know.

PostPosted: Sun Sep 02, 2007 4:10 pm    Post subject: Reply with quote

Again, this happens sometimes, and I don't know why. Instead of bid confirmation page, ebay returns the process to the beginning, returning the listing page.

PostPosted: Sun Sep 02, 2007 4:16 pm    Post subject: Reply with quote

An interesting thing is though, when this happens, it happens for several snipes in a row, regardless of users and auctions in question. So it could be an ebay related thing, or I have a glitch somewhere (cookies being deleted from temp dir). I'll investigate this further.
